A mapcode is a code consisting of two groups of letters and digits, separated by a dot. It represents a location on the surface of the Earth. The mapcode system is a free, brand-less, international standard for representing any location anywhere. It is a short, easy to recognize and remember “code”, between 4 and 7 characters long. Accurate enough for public, every-day use, mapcodes are supported in over 60m car navigation devices world-wide. Soon after the GPS satellite signals were opened up for civilian use, Pieter Geelen and Harold Goddijn, the founders of TomTom, developed Mapcodes. Mapcodes greatly benefit a large spectrum of the world’s population, particularly those of developing countries so a rapid worldwide adoption is desired. Therefore, mapcodes have been donated to the public domain as a free, open source and unbranded opportunity for anyone, anywhere. To manage this; the Mapcode Foundation was established in the Netherlands in 2013 as an independent, non-profit organization. Its purpose is to foster mapcodes as a standard of public location encoding, and to provide, support, distribute and stimulate the use of mapcodes, free of charge, as widely as possible.
